In the first part of The Art of Seduction Robert Greene describes the different personality types and character traits of the best seducers.

#1. Sirens

The siren is highly sexual, confident, offering the promise of endless pleasure and a bit of danger.
The examples are Cleopatra and Marilyn Monroe.

#2. The Rake

The Rake insatiably adores the opposite sex, and their desire is infectious.

The Rake is a great female fantasy-figure: when he desires a woman he will do anything for her. Sure he may be disloyal, but that only adds to his appeal.

The Rake is a guilty pleasure offering what society does not allow women: an affair of pure pleasure with the added bonus of danger.

#3. Charmer

Charmers want to please and know how to please: they are highly skilled social creatures.

Charmers seduce by removing themselves from the equation and taking full interest on their victims.
They will know what makes you tick, understand your pains and… Your weaknesses. Charmers make you feel understood and they feel better about yourself.

The Dangers of Charm

Robert Greene righteously says that some people tend to view Charmers as slippery and deceitful, and it can create problems for you.

Charmers must know then when to get rid of their flexibility and start acting inflexible.

#6. Dandies

Dandies like to play with their image, creating a striking and androgynous allure.

They live for pleasure and surround themselves with beauty.

The sexes tend to have a chasm between them and they don’t understand the other. The Dandy is reassuring and feels comfortable for having similar traits.
The key is ambiguity: you are heterosexual, but you move delightfully back and forth between the two poles.

A difference with the Rake is that while the Rake’s insolence is tied to conquering a woman, the insolence of the Dandy is aimed at society and conventions: it’s no a woman he’s trying to conquer, but a whole social world.

#7. Naturals

Naturals are spontaneous and open.

They bring us back to childhood, the golden paradise we consciously or unconsciously try to recreate.
They bring us back to that time by embodying those child-like qualities such as spontaneity and sincerity.

The key is to infuse your play with the conviction and feeling of a child, making it seem natural. The more absorbed you seem in your own joy-filled world, the more seductive you become.

Dangers of Naturals

Total childishness can be annoying, so the best Naturals combine adult traits like experience and wisdom with a childlike manner.
It’s the mixture of qualities that is most attractive.

#8. Coquettes

Coquettes are self-sufficient.

They seem to say they don’t need you, and their narcissism is devilishly attractive.
Imitate the alternating heat and coolness of the Coquette to make your target chase even harder.

The real essence of Coquettes is to trap people emotionally. The secret of the coquette it’s not much tease and temptation, the secret weapon of the coquettes is emotional withdrawal.

Their withdrawal makes them mysterious… And it makes us insecure.
What if they’ve lost interest?

Anti-seducers

Greene dedicates a chapter to the personalities and traits of the anti-seducers.
Avoid them at all costs unless you want to repel everyone:

  • Brute: no patience and wants to skip seduction
  • Suffocator: cling incessantly & loves too soon
  • Moralizer: wants you to become like they want you to be
  • Tightwad: money above seduction
  • Bumbler: self-conscious and awkward
  • Windbag: talk incessantly
  • Reactor: terrified of having their ego hurt
  • Vulgarian: ignores the rules of seduction and yet expects to win.
  • Greedy: make it too obvious they’re after things

The 18 Types of Seducer Victims

Don’t think that everyone lacks what you are lacking and don’t try to seduce your own type.

  1. Reformed Rake or Siren: long to escape what restricted their freedom
  2. Disappointed Dreamer: stuck in a boring life and long for adventure
  3. Pampered Royal: long for prince charming to let them live the pampered fantasy of a royal life
  4. New Prude: concerned with appearance and judgment, secretly long release
  5. Crushed Star: long to being adored again
  6. Novice: excited of being introduced to a new, darker world…
  7. Conquerer: give them an obstacle to overcome or a mission
  8. Exotic Fetishist: want novelty, experiences, edgy stuff
  9. Drama Queen: long for drama in their lives
  10. Professor: analyze and ponder, but long being overwhelmed by a free spirit
  11. Beauty: used to being appreciated. Focus on hidden features like her intellect or wit
  12. Aging Baby: immature and looking for supportive parent
  13. Rescuer: long to feel like they’re saving someone
  14. The Roué: experienced in life and desire to educate someone more naive.
  15. Idol Worshipper: seeking for a meaning in life
  16. Sensualist: driven by their senses. Overwhelm their sight, smell, and touch
  17. Lonely Leader: they’re not used to being bossed. Act as their equal or superior
  18. Floating Gender: float with them

#17. Effect a Regression

The Art of Seduction brings us a super powerful tool when it introduces the Regression.
Regression leverages the transfer phenomenon of psychoanalysis.

Ask about their childhood. As they talk, adopt a therapist pose. Be attentive but quiet, interject with nonjudgmental comments to keep them talking.

Don’t just talk though, you want people to act out their memories in the present. Make your target feel like they are getting what they always missed with you.

The Art of Seduction describes the four types of regression:

  • Infantile: the first bond with a mother is the most powerful one. The key for the regression is the unconditional love a mother has for the infant.
  • Oedipal: must be tailored to your target because you play the parental role
  • Ego Ideal: let them feel they are getting close to being the person they wanted to be.
  • Reverse Parental: here you play the role of the child instead. Cute, adorable, but also sexual child.

Some types are more vulnerable to a regression:

  • Serious and “adult”
  • Full of themselves
  • Seem in command

They’re often over-compensating.
And positions of power can be more of a burden they subconsciously want to be free of.
